| Sponsored NEOVAR log. Intro: I have just wrapped up my 8wk Epistane pulse cycle(cut) and it is now time to grow for the winter. I dropped from 205 or so, to 185 this AM, all while keeping/adding LBM. I have taken the last 2 weeks just cruising in the gym, and focusing on resting my body after an intense blast DC training. I have discontinued all stim use, and been running Reset AD for the past 2 weeks as well. Now it is time to gain as much LBM, with as little fat gain as i can, over the winter. Starting Weight 185.2 Training Style- Dc Training. I have been doing this with great results for some time now. Diet- I am going to be following the Scivation Lean Mass Diet. i will be following the 3500cal outline. Details on "The lean mass Diet" can be seen HERE Goals- Short term goals is to gain 10lbs of LBM over the winter. And really focus on getting as strong as possable. Long term i would really like to see myself at 210 10-11% bf. So that is about 25-30lbs of lean mass i would need to get me there. Neovar dosing Training days- I will be dosing 4caps 15min before i eat my pre workout meal(5:30am). I am usually in the gym an hour after i eat my preworkout meal. Second dose will be post workout 15min prior to my post workout meal. Both my pre-workout, and post-workout meals contain 75g of carbs consisting of oats, and fruit. Neovar dosing non-training days- I will dose 4 caps 15 min prior to breakfast, and 4 caps 15min prior to my 4th meal(3pm or so) Other Supplements- I am really trying to level the playing field here, and will only be taking Orange Triad(multi vit.), and Dymatize Elite whey, along with the NEOVAR. I may add RPM and drive later on in the log, after i have ran NEOVAR solo for a while. Initial Impressions I started taking NEOVAR yesterday. So far not much to note.
